Maxwell’s Point of Sale has two key experiences: the Borrower Hub and the Lender Hub.
The Borrower Hub
The borrower hub is a consumer-facing mobile-first web experience which guides borrowers through a custom workflow to complete a loan application.
The borrower hub is designed as a single destination for borrowers to view and provide all update for their loan application. So even if your team uses multiple tools behind the scenes. Borrowers always come back to one place for updates and requests. The Borrower Hub is where your borrowers:
Start and complete their loan applications
Review and provide consents and authorizations (eConsent, Credit, HELOC, ARM, etc.)
Receive notifications on upcoming tasks to be done
Securely upload documents, provide required information, and enter credentials for services like VOA/VOE.
Review product & pricing options
Review and e-sign documents, disclosures, and closing documents
Communicate with your team members on all things related to your loan.
Depending on the setup, each client may have an unlimited number of parallel experiences, called sites. These can be used to configure experiences for different branches, channels, or loan purposes.
Lender Hub
The Lender Hub is where your team logs in to manage your pipeline and work loan files. Loan Officers, LO Assistants, Processors, Managers, and Administrators all use the Lender Hub to:
Collaborate on loans from initial application through e-closing
Communicate with borrowers in a centralized workspace
Create follow up tasks for borrowers to complete
Run key pre-qual services like credit, pricing, AUS
Sync key information and documentation collected to your LOS
When your team is aligned in the point Lender Hub, you reduce time spent chasing emails, documents, and info across multiple system and streamline both internal communication and the borrower experience.
